The Thomas Paine Podcast presents a vivid, nostalgic play-by-play of the August 31, 1969, baseball game between the Philadelphia Phillies and the Los Angeles Dodgers at Dodger Stadium. Hosted by Ben Stilling and later Jerry Doggett, the broadcast captures the tension of a tight contest, with Bill Singer pitching masterfully for the Dodgers, ultimately securing his 17th win. The game features standout performances, including Willie Crawford’s home run, a crucial triple by Johnny Callison off a ricochet off the box seat railing, and Maury Wills’ base-stealing prowess. The Dodgers’ 4-1 victory completes a sweep of the Phillies, setting the stage for an upcoming matchup with the New York Mets. The broadcast is rich with period-specific advertising, including Schlitz malt liquor, Farmer John wieners, Bergie beer, Union 76 gasoline, and Camp West campers, reflecting the cultural and commercial landscape of 1969. The episode also includes personal anecdotes, player profiles, and commentary on baseball’s evolving traditions and the significance of the game’s centennial anniversary.
Bill Singer earned his 17th win, pitching a complete game with 7 strikeouts and just 1 run allowed.
Johnny Callison’s triple off the box seat railing in left field was a pivotal moment, scoring the Phillies’ only run.
The Dodgers swept the Phillies in the series, setting up a high-stakes Labor Day matchup with the New York Mets.
Farmer John, Schlitz, and Union 76 were prominent sponsors, reflecting 1960s consumer culture.
The game was broadcast with rich storytelling, player bios, and nostalgic commentary on baseball’s 100th anniversary.
